Revealing the historical evolution of steel fenestration

The record of steel windows goes back to the 19th century, evolving from early cast iron and wrought iron applications to the sophisticated architectural steel windows seen today. Initially, metal windows were primarily employed in industrial settings, giving origin to the term industrial windows, prized for their might and skill to span big openings. These early steel windows paved the way for more advanced designs and wider adoption.

By the early 20th century, steel fenestration gained important traction in both steel commercial windows and emerging residential designs. The inherent durability and thin profiles offered by steel windows presented distinct steel windows advantages over other materials, leading to their integration into grand public buildings and upscale homes. This period indicated the transition towards truly architectural windows, with modern steel windows increasingly liked for their sleek aesthetics and robust performance, laying the groundwork for contemporary steel residential windows and fold steel architectural windows solutions.

Comprehending the construction of steel window frames

Grasping the fundamental construction of Steel Windows is vital for appreciating their durability and design versatility. Typically, Steel Windows frames are fabricated from hot-rolled or cold-rolled steel profiles, meticulously welded at the corners to create a robust, seamless unit. This process allows for unbelievable strength in slender sections, enabling extensive glazing areas and maximizing natural light, a hallmark of superb Steel Windows design.

The complex manufacturing process supports various steel window designs and steel window styles, including traditional steel awning windows, imposing steel bay windows, and smooth steel picture windows. Customization is inherent in Steel Windows, with individual components precisely cut and joined to meet certain architectural requirements. This allows for virtually limitless custom steel windows, supporting original aesthetic visions for any interior space. The inherent strength of steel frames also contributes to the durability and low maintenance requirements often associated with high-quality Steel Windows installations.

Key glazing selections and thermal performance features for steel windows

Contemporary steel windows present excellent thermal performance through advanced glazing and thermally broken frame designs. These innovations ensure that steel windows contribute favorably to a building's energy efficiency, especially critical for Nederland homes.

The key to enhanced thermal performance in steel frame windows resides in the implementation of thermally broken technology. This comprises creating a barrier within the steel frames themselves, hindering the transfer of heat or cold through the metal. Coupled with high-performance glazing options like double or triple-pane insulated glass units (IGUs), steel framed windows productively lessen heat loss in winter and heat gain in summer. Specialists in steel window frames understand that selecting the suitable glass coatings and gas fills (argon or krypton) within the IGUs further optimizes the thermal resistance of steel windows, making them a smart choice for various climates.

Recommended advice for steel window system installation

Correct installation is paramount for maximizing the duration and performance of Steel Windows. Achieving best thermal performance relies heavily on meticulous sealing around the entire steel window installation, preventing air and moisture infiltration. Selecting appropriate glazing options and ensuring they are correctly seated within the frame significantly impacts the overall thermal efficiency of Steel Windows.

The accurate setting of Steel Windows, including ensuring level and plumb positioning, is vital. Careful handling of the glazing during installation prevents damage and ensures a secure, thermally sound seal. For glass windows, especially those with specialized glazing options, right shimming and anchoring are important to maintain structural integrity and avoid stress on the steel windows frames over time.

Your manual to likening steel with other window frame materials

While numerous materials exist for window frames, Steel Windows provide distinct benefits over aluminum, vinyl, and wood options. Unlike aluminum, Steel Windows possess superior strength-to-weight ratios, allowing for incredibly narrow frames and larger glass expanses without compromising structural integrity or long-term durability. The inherent strength of steel also contributes to excellent weatherization, creating strong seals at vital points like sills.

Compared to vinyl, Steel Windows hold unmatched toughness against temperature fluctuations and UV degradation, preventing warping or fading over time. Furthermore, the longevity and minimal maintenance of Steel Windows often outperform even bronze alternatives, especially concerning long-term structural performance in demanding climates. The capability of steel to accommodate heavy doors and large glass panels for expansive views further sets it apart, a critical element for many steel windows design ideas.
